3306 发表于 2023-4-12 09:18:04

串口屏文本刷新抖动的问题

串口屏的文本在显示的时候闪烁其他的数,但是单片机没有给他发刷新指令。是为啥?

If后要接end 发表于 2023-4-12 10:17:02

把通信断开了,也会刷新?看一下是不是脚本写了什么程序,给这个文本控件赋值了

3306 发表于 2023-4-12 17:02:34

If后要接end 发表于 2023-4-12 10:17
把通信断开了,也会刷新?看一下是不是脚本写了什么程序,给这个文本控件赋值了 ...

没有,有可能是232通信那块有干扰,加校验位是否能够解决这种情况

If后要接end 发表于 2023-4-12 17:36:20

3306 发表于 2023-4-12 17:02
没有,有可能是232通信那块有干扰,加校验位是否能够解决这种情况

可以在工程设置里面开启CR16校验

3306 发表于 2023-4-13 11:22:50

If后要接end 发表于 2023-4-12 17:36
可以在工程设置里面开启CR16校验
加校验解决了,有可能是指令编码最后一个位翻转了,导致的。

3306 发表于 2023-4-14 17:17:32

If后要接end 发表于 2023-4-12 17:36
可以在工程设置里面开启CR16校验

M系列处理单片机指令的速度是多少啊?

If后要接end 发表于 2023-4-17 08:37:49

3306 发表于 2023-4-14 17:17
M系列处理单片机指令的速度是多少啊?

基本是毫秒级

3306 发表于 2023-4-17 09:12:32

If后要接end 发表于 2023-4-17 08:37
基本是毫秒级

一百毫秒能处理一条,那刷新界面的时候,同时刷新好几个文本,单片机几微秒内发送几条指令,是不是就会出问题

If后要接end 发表于 2023-4-17 09:49:53

3306 发表于 2023-4-17 09:12
一百毫秒能处理一条,那刷新界面的时候,同时刷新好几个文本,单片机几微秒内发送几条指令,是不是就会出 ...

批量刷文本可以用批量更新的指令,不用一条条发

3306 发表于 2023-4-17 10:00:24

If后要接end 发表于 2023-4-17 09:49
批量刷文本可以用批量更新的指令,不用一条条发

同一界面显示采集不同的传感器的值可以用批量更新吗?
页: [1] 2
查看完整版本: 串口屏文本刷新抖动的问题